Transaction 7724b6cc0189be146f158cac636869ddd7a2572b231bcc831d755cf3e7d87aad
1 Input
2 Outputs
- 7724b6cc0189be146f158cac636869ddd7a2572b231bcc831d755cf3e7d87aad:0
- 7724b6cc0189be146f158cac636869ddd7a2572b231bcc831d755cf3e7d87aad:1
value 8147329
address 3FZbJRczW8HXF8D61SeyuKmwby97cT2Kgs
value 58139
address 114iqLELdVvCeJW6AAExzY5EzRYsFGt1Vi